Code Analysis: ActivityPub 4.2.0

Most Complex Functions

Function Rating Complexity
Activitypub\Signature::verify_http_signature()
B
22
Activitypub\Transformer\Post::get_media_from_blocks()
B
18
Activitypub\Integration\Enable_Mastodon_Apps::api_statuses_external()
B
17
Activitypub\Signature::get_signed_data()
B
17
Activitypub\Handler\Delete::handle_delete()
B
17
Activitypub\Activitypub::render_activitypub_template()
A
16
Activitypub\Scheduler::schedule_post_activity()
A
15
get_remote_metadata_by_actor()
A
13
Activitypub\Link::replace_with_links()
A
14
Activitypub\Collection\Actors::get_by_resource()
A
13
Activitypub\Rest\Outbox::user_outbox_get()
A
12
Activitypub\Http::get_remote_object()
A
12